 FFI-5909 is a cyanide-free zinc leaching process, specially designed for depositing electroless nickel on aluminum alloy, which is plated with a thin zinc layer on the aluminum alloy to prevent the oxidation of aluminum alloy.


 FFI-5909 can be plating directly on the zinc layer also such as copper, nickel and other processes.


 FFI-5909 can produce a more fine and uniform zinc layer. This film of aluminum has good bonding force to ensure that subsequent electroplating bonding force.


 FFI-5909 easily immersed in blind holes, cracks, thread, grooves and other inaccessible areas that using traditional zincate solution concentration electroplating, it can also be applied to large area of aluminum plate surface leaching of zinc.


 FFI-5909 has wide operation range, good corrosion resistance of the edges, reduce the peeling and improve the surface adjustment force.


 FFI-5909 can reduce the cost of cyanide treatment, storage and processing of materials and saving storage space. And do not have to do 2 times zincate treatment.

 

EQUIPMENT REQUIREMENT Equipment: FFI-5909 can work in a steel tank or barrel. If heating is required, flat rims are recommended. Because the operating temperature range is wide, the manual operating temperature regulator can be used instead of the automatic temperature controller. Control: The concentration of FFI-5909 is not very important for most aluminum alloy plating. However, some of the harder-plated alloys (such as the 5000 series) suggest concentration of 30%. The simplest control method is to observe the gas on the surface of the aluminum. When the solution is consumed, there will be significant gas. The solution should be increased by about 10% of the initial quantity of Make-up.
